Job Description
STOP - Please Read This First
Before you click "Apply," take a moment to truly understand what we're offering.
This isn't just another job posting to add to your application count. This is a career opportunity that deserves your full attention.
Here's what we're asking:
- Read the complete Job Description below carefully
- Understand the role, responsibilities, and requirements
- Assess if this aligns with YOUR career goals
- Only then click "Apply" if you're genuinely interested
Why does this matter? We're looking for candidates who are intentional about their career choicespeople who take time to evaluate opportunities rather than mass-applying to dozens of positions. If you rush through this posting, we'll likely notice in your application.
Quality candidates read carefully. Are you one of them?
The full Job Description is below. Please read it thoroughly before applying.
__________________________________________________
Experience: Minimum 6 years in software testing, including at least 4 years of deep hands-on experience in API and Web automation solving a wide range of complex, real-world quality engineering and automation challenges.
Work Location-Bagmane constellation business park sapient
Interview location-Bagmane constellation business park sapient
Role & responsibilities
- Design and build test automation frameworks from scratch and evolve them through continuous improvements, scalability enhancements, CI/CD integration, and long-term maintenance.
- Engineer solutions using Java, Selenium, RestAssured, TestNG/JUnit, Maven/Gradle, and integrate automated pipelines using Jenkins/GitHub Actions.
- Implement advanced reporting with Allure/Extent, and develop robust utilities for logging, configuration management, and test data handling.
- Interact directly with clients to understand requirements, provide technical guidance, and represent the automation strategy.
- Lead a small team of automation engineers, drive best practices, and mentor junior members.
- Ensure high-quality, on-time delivery of automation solutions across sprints and releases.
Preferred candidate profile
- Around 6 years of hands-on experience in API and Web test automation.
- Proven track record of building test automation frameworks from scratch on the Java stack.
- Ability to architect scalable, maintainable solutions not just write scripts.
- Strong grip on Core Java, OOP, Collections, Streams, design patterns.
Hands-on with Selenium, RestAssured, TestNG/JUnit, Maven/Gradle.
- Experience developing custom utilities, reporting plugins, wrappers, and reusable modules.
- Real-world experience integrating frameworks with Jenkins/GitHub Actions.
Understanding of pipelines, parallel execution, environment handling, and artifact management.
- Proved experience of guiding 3-4 automation engineers.
- Conduct code reviews, enforce best practices, and drive quality engineering culture.
- Comfortable interacting with clients, gathering requirements, presenting solutions, and explaining technical decisions.
- Ability to translate business needs into automation strategy.
- Someone who takes accountability for timely, high-quality delivery.
Proactive with planning, estimation, and risk management.
- Looks at automation as a productcontinuously improving, optimizing, scaling, and stabilizing the framework.
- Strong debugging skills across UI, API, test data, environments, pipelines, and integrations.
Job Classification
Industry: IT Services & Consulting
Functional Area / Department: Engineering - Software & QA
Role Category: Quality Assurance and Testing
Role: Software Developer in Test (SDET)
Employement Type: Full time
Contact Details:
Company: Sapient
Location(s): Bengaluru
Keyskills:
Java
Rest Assured
Selenium
Java Collections
Postman
Stubbing
Lambda Expressions
Pojo
Bdd
Design Patterns
Data Structures
Code Coverage
JSON
Ci/Cd
shift left
Microservices
Selenium Grid
POM
TDD
Singleton
Mocking
Exception Handling
Streams
Framework Development